Switch in 5 minutes.
You don't have to do it all at once. Run both bots side-by-side, replicate features one by one, then disable MEE6.
Install Nexus on your server
One-click invite from getnexus.me. Bot lands online in seconds — no reboot, no manual setup. Keep MEE6 running in parallel for now.
Recreate your top MEE6 commands via AI
Open the AI Command Builder and describe what you want: "create a leveling system based on messages sent" or "add a /warn command that bans after 3 warnings". Nexus generates and deploys each command in seconds.
Export your MEE6 data (optional)
From the MEE6 dashboard, export your leveling leaderboard as CSV. Drop it into a Nexus AI prompt to bulk-import the starting levels. Same for any custom command lists you want to bring over.
Disable MEE6 features one at a time
As each Nexus feature replaces a MEE6 feature, toggle the MEE6 module off. When everything is migrated, kick MEE6 from the server. Zero downtime, zero data loss for the features you've moved.

Level data lives on MEE6's servers, so it can't be migrated automatically. MEE6 lets you export your leaderboard as a CSV from your server's dashboard. You can then bulk-import it into Nexus's leveling system with a single AI prompt: "create a leveling system and import these starting levels" + the CSV. Takes about two minutes.
Almost. Nexus matches MEE6 on moderation, welcome messages, leveling, tickets, custom commands, audit logs, and the dashboard. The one feature MEE6 has that Nexus doesn't is built-in music playback — Discord's API restrictions make this expensive to operate, and we've prioritised other capabilities. If music is your main need, MEE6 is the better fit.
Yes, significantly. Nexus Pro at €5/month covers 15 Discord servers with unlimited custom commands. MEE6 Premium is $11.99/month for a single server (or $49.99/year, or $89.99 lifetime — still one server per subscription). For 3 servers on MEE6 Premium you'd pay around $36/month — vs €5/month for the same on Nexus Pro. The gap widens further at 5+ servers, and Nexus Pro pays for itself in under 6 months even compared to MEE6's lifetime plan.
MEE6's auto-moderation matches keywords, regex patterns, and Discord's basic filters. Nexus uses contextual AI that reads the meaning of a message rather than just matching strings — so it catches paraphrased slurs and coded harassment that keyword filters miss, with fewer false positives on slang and edge cases. Both run server-side; neither stores message content beyond the moderation decision.
